A leaf peeling of Tradescantia is kept in a medium having 10% NaCl. After a few minutes, when we observe the leaf peel under the microscope, we are likely to see
A. Diffusion of NaCl into the cell
B. The exit of water from the cell.
C. The entry of water into the cell.
D. The cells bursting out
Solution
Osmosis is the procedure where there is the movement of solvents, takes place and this occurs through a semipermeable membrane, and this osmosis is the biological procedure that occurs in many or various process of both plants and animals.
Complete answer: The term osmosis has a different explanation in biology and chemistry, wherein biology is defined as passive transport of substances such as solvent through the semipermeable membrane, but in chemistry, they define osmosis based on the concentration of the solution.
Where there are different types of solutions, such as hypertonic, hypotonic, and isotonic, where the hypertonic solution is that concentration of solutes is more than that of solvents, and the hypotonic solution is that concentration of solvent is more than that of solute, and if the concentration of solvent and solute both are same then it is said to be the isotonic solution.
And the liquids always move from higher concentration to lower concentration, in the above question they had taken leaf peeling of Tradescantia and placed them in 10% NaCl solution.
As the concentration of NaCl solution is greater compared to the concentration of cells in the leaf peeling, so that there is passive diffusion takes place, and the water in the plant cells moves to the solution, so that it lost the water content of the protoplasm of the cell, and undergoes shrinkage of cells.
So the correct option is B.
